Understanding Market Capitalization

Market capitalization, often abbreviated as market cap, is a key metric used to assess the size and value of a publicly traded cryptocurrency. It is calculated by multiplying the current market price of a cryptocurrency by the total number of coins in circulation. A higher market cap typically indicates a more established and widely adopted cryptocurrency.

Factors Influencing Market Capitalization

Several factors influence the market capitalization of a cryptocurrency, including:

  • Supply and Demand: The total supply and demand for a cryptocurrency significantly impact its market cap.
  • Price Volatility: Cryptocurrencies are known for their high price volatility, which can lead to fluctuations in market cap.
  • Adoption and Usage: The level of adoption and usage of a cryptocurrency as a form of payment or in decentralized applications (dApps) contributes to its market cap.
  • Technology and Development: Advancements and developments in a cryptocurrency's underlying technology can boost its market cap.

Importance of Market Capitalization

Market capitalization provides valuable insights for investors and traders in the crypto market:

  • Risk Assessment: Cryptocurrencies with higher market caps tend to be perceived as less risky, as they have a larger investor base and more established track records.
  • Investment Decisions: Market cap can inform investment decisions by highlighting the relative size and potential of different cryptocurrencies.
  • Market Trends: Tracking the market caps of major cryptocurrencies can provide an indication of overall market sentiment and trends.
